摘要
Monoclinic (001) and (110)-oriented La2NiMnO6 films were grown on (001) SrTiO3 and (001) (LaAlO3)(0.3)-(SrAl1/2Ta1/2O3)(0.7) substrates, respectively, by pulsed-laser deposition. The crystal structures, magnetic properties, and the Raman spectrum have been studied on films with different growth conditions. Analysis of the magnetization, x-ray diffraction, and the Raman spectroscopy measurements demonstrate that the B-site cationic ordering, which is sensitive to both growth conditions and the lattice mismatch with the substrate, affects the magnetic properties.
